Provenance walkthrough (Figure 3 / SI S2 / Evidence req #6)
A worked trace of one SKILL.md instruction back through _provenance.json to its Mold and its source reference, with the byte-identity recomputed and verified, not asserted. This satisfies Evidence requirement #6 and is the concrete instance behind Figure 3.
All paths are in the Foundry repo at commit e54b9d4 (implement-galaxy-workflow-test Mold revision 7). Cast: casts/claude/skills/implement-galaxy-workflow-test/. This Mold sits in the demonstrated interview-to-galaxy spine (phase: implement-test).
The chain (top → bottom)
1. The instruction in the generated skill.
SKILL.md step “Author assertions” tells the runtime agent:
Materialize the plan’s assertion intent into concrete output assertions. Choose assertion families and tolerances per planemo-asserts-idioms; check each shortcut against iwc-shortcuts-anti-patterns so an existence-only or size-only assertion is a deliberate choice, not an evasion.
The same skill declares the reference and its disclosure trigger:
references/notes/planemo-asserts-idioms.md: Research note copied verbatim into the bundle. Choose assertion families, tolerance magnitudes, and the static/Planemo validation loop. Use when: writing or revising output assertions for a Galaxy workflow test file.
This is progressive disclosure in the artifact: the instruction names the note, the note is carried on-demand, and the trigger says when to open it.
2. The provenance record. _provenance.json refs[] carries the matching entry:
{
"kind": "research",
"mode": "verbatim",
"ref": "[[planemo-asserts-idioms]]",
"src": "content/research/planemo-asserts-idioms.md",
"dst": "references/notes/planemo-asserts-idioms.md",
"used_at": "runtime",
"load": "on-demand",
"evidence": "corpus-observed",
"src_hash": "9d87cd37efcc3f5e3a378011892f3846c8fdecec7a5765193044d71edb746ed9",
"dst_hash": "9d87cd37efcc3f5e3a378011892f3846c8fdecec7a5765193044d71edb746ed9",
"source": "deterministic"
}
src_hash == dst_hash and source: deterministic is the claim: the cast copied the note verbatim, no LLM in the path.
3. The source note in the knowledge base. content/research/planemo-asserts-idioms.md (type: research, subtype: component, revision 6). This is the human-inspectable, single source a maintainer edits once.
4. The Mold manifest that drove the copy. content/molds/implement-galaxy-workflow-test/index.md declares the reference in its typed references: block — the same metadata the validator audits and the caster dispatches on:
- kind: research
ref: "[[planemo-asserts-idioms]]"
used_at: runtime
load: on-demand
mode: verbatim
evidence: corpus-observed
purpose: "Choose assertion families, tolerance magnitudes, and the static/Planemo validation loop."
trigger: "When writing or revising output assertions for a Galaxy workflow test file."
The Mold itself is pinned in provenance: path content/molds/implement-galaxy-workflow-test/index.md, revision 7, content_hash 7f68fe27…, commit e54b9d4.
Verification (recomputed, not asserted)
$ shasum -a 256 content/research/planemo-asserts-idioms.md \
casts/.../references/notes/planemo-asserts-idioms.md
9d87cd37…f6ed9 content/research/planemo-asserts-idioms.md
9d87cd37…f6ed9 casts/.../references/notes/planemo-asserts-idioms.md # identical
# matches _provenance.json src_hash AND dst_hash
$ shasum -a 256 content/molds/implement-galaxy-workflow-test/index.md
7f68fe27…f82a # matches _provenance.json mold.content_hash
Both recomputed digests equal the recorded ones exactly. A reviewer can: (a) confirm the skill instruction came from a specific note, (b) confirm the note was copied unmodified, and (c) confirm the Mold body is the exact revision recorded — all from the committed repo, no trust required.

Honesty notes
- The source note carries
ai_generated: true; itsevidencetier iscorpus-observed(declared in the manifest). Provenance proves where the bytes came from and that they were copied unaltered — it does not, by itself, certify the note’s content is corpus-earned. That is the separate corpus-first discipline the manuscript already flags as an audit aid, not a guarantee. - Line numbers are omitted from quotes because
SKILL.mdis regenerated; quotes are pinned by commite54b9d4instead. - This is a deterministic (verbatim) reference, the cleanest trace. An LLM-condensed reference would instead show
source: llmwith the prompt identity and model recorded — a second walkthrough worth adding to SI to show that path too.
